Regenerative Gardening Program
Monthly outdoor sessions designed for both adults and children. Together, we will plant seeds, care for growing plants, meet pollinators and friendly garden insects, discover the secrets of medicinal herbs, harvest and preserve food, cook with fresh ingredients. Rooted in the gentle wisdom of Permaculture, this program goes beyond teaching gardening skills — it offers a grounding, calming experience that helps families reconnect with nature and each other. Along the way, we will discover where food truly comes from, why every creature in the garden matters, and how to live in harmony with the rhythms of the natural world. Perfect for families who already love plants and want to deepen their knowledge, this program will equip you with lifelong skills while nurturing a sense of wonder, care, and responsibility for the earth.

What’s Included:
Each month will focus on a unique theme to deepen our connection with the garden and the natural world. Together, we will explore the importance of water and irrigation, gain a deeper understanding of plants and seeds, and practice the art of propagation. Along the way, children and caregivers will discover the magic of “friendship plants” through companion planting, learn natural ways to manage pests, and meet the pollinators that keep our gardens thriving. We’ll also get to know medicinal and useful plants, enjoy cooking and experimenting with herbal remedies, and practice simple methods of preserving food. As the journey unfolds, participants will come to appreciate the animals that share our garden space and, finally, bring all their learning together by designing their very own garden — a space where creativity, care, and nature come alive.
